Dieselmoottorivaunut, known in English as diesel multiple units (DMUs), are self-propelled railway coaches powered by diesel engines. They are a common form of rail traction, particularly on routes where electrification is not economically viable or where flexibility in service is required. A diesel multiple unit typically consists of two or more carriages permanently or semi-permanently coupled, with at least one carriage containing a diesel engine and transmission system to propel the train. Other carriages may be unpowered trailers or can also be powered.
